Написать скрипт прайс-листа для ИМ мотоэкипировки
Создать (можно на основе имеющегося) скрипт прайс-листа следующим функционалом:
1. закрыть скрипт паролем (чтобы посторонние не могли его использовать).
2. Возможна гибкая настройка разбивки разделов каталога по разным страницам и порядка расположения разделов на странице. Разделов, но не подразделов, то есть "МотоШлема" и "МотоКуртки" можно разместить на одной или разных страницах и в разном порядке, но подразделы "Открытые мотошлема" и "Мотошлема интегралы" всегда вложены в раздел "МотоШлема".
3. Можно установить галочку "отделить бренды". Разбивка по брендам в каждом подразделе своя. Товары, для которых бренд не указан, считаются товарами с брендом Noname.
4. Бренды можно включать или не включать в прайс-лист (включить все, включить только один, включить некоторые).
5. Картинки товаров в прайс-листе – ссылки на карточки товаров на сайте.
6. Ширина столбца с картинками 14.
7. Оставить существующую галочку "Выгружать остатки".
8. Должна быть возможность загрузить файл с шапкой прайс-листа (указать, с какой строки начинается прайс-лист, все что выше, берется из шапки).
9. Добавить галочку "прас-лист с со сворачивающимися категориями" (смотри приложенный пример).
10. Добавить переключатель: "не сортировать – сортировать по имени – сортировать по цене от большего к меньшему – сортировать по цене от меньшего к большему".
11. Добавить возможность запоминать конфигурацию настроек прайс-листа (профили).
(для каждого пользователя свой конфиг)
Таблицы с которыми работать:
SC_categories
SC_products
SC_product_pictures
SC_product_options
SC_product_options_set
SC_product_options_values
(тот, кто работал с shop-script (old) думаю все знают)